Meet Cameron Dallas, the 21-year-old social media star who shut down Milan Fashion Week

Internet personality Cameron Dallas at the Milan Fashion Week on Jan 17, 2016. PHOTO: AFP

MILAN (BLOOMBERG) - Meet Cameron Dallas.

Despite the plethora of beautiful, memorable looks and collections at Milan Fashion Week, the autumn/winter 2016 season will easily be remembered as the one the 21-year-old social media star (go ahead, Google him) overshadowed a collective industry...by just showing up.

The native Californian's attendance at the Calvin Klein show on Sunday caused pandemonium (think Beatlesmania for the uber-savvy You Tube generation), the likes of which not even hardcore fashion veterans had ever seen before (not even for rapper Kanye West).

Needless to say, those who admittedly might not have known who Dallas was four days ago certainly know now.

The New York Times said thousands gathered unexpectedly, behind hastily erected barricades, outside the Calvin Klein show, in the hope of catching sight of Dallas. He duly emerged onto a balcony and waved to the crowd.

Dallas, who gained popularity by posting videos of his antics on Vine, now has 9.1 million followers on the app, 5.99 million on Twitter and 9.6 million on Instagram.

"It's the Rolling Stones, the Beatles and Justin Bieber rolled into one," 032C editor Joerg Koch was quoted by the Times as saying of the uproar created by the new social media stars in Milan.

They included model and Instagram star Lucky Blue Smith, who hundreds showed up to see on Saturday.

The fans gathered outside Palazzo Ralph Lauren, screaming whenever Smith - who hails from Utah, and, yes, Lucky Blue Smith is his real name - appeared.
